Why Some People Have More: Marxism and Family in Capitalism

The Marxist theory of social class inequality explains how capitalism creates and maintains class divisions through various social institutions, particularly emphasizing the role of family in capitalism according to Marxism as a key mechanism for reproducing social inequality.

  • Marxism identifies two main social classes: the Proletariat (working class) and the Bourgeoisie (ruling class), with limited social mobility between them
  • The theory emphasizes how social institutions like family, education, and religion help maintain capitalist system through socialization
  • Key differences between Marxism and Functionalism theories lie in their fundamental views - Marxism sees society as conflict-based while Functionalism views it as consensus-based
  • The family serves as an ideological apparatus that transmits ruling class values and maintains social order
  • Critical evaluations highlight limitations in Marxist theory, particularly regarding gender inequality and family diversity

Page 1: Marxist Theory and Social Class Structure

This page introduces the fundamental concepts of Marxist theory as a conflict-based perspective on society. It explains how social class divisions are maintained through various socialization mechanisms and institutions.

Definition: Marxism is a conflict theory that views society as structured around class inequalities with limited individual free will.

Vocabulary: Proletariat refers to the working class who sell their labor, while Bourgeoisie represents the ruling class who own the means of production.

Highlight: Althusser's concept of the family as an ideological State Apparatus demonstrates how family institutions support capitalism by transmitting ruling class values.

Example: Primary socialization occurs in early years through family, while secondary socialization happens through institutions like education, religion, and media.

Quote: "Religion and the family act like a safety valve releasing the stresses of capitalist life and giving the individual the illusion that society is fair."
